English edit
Etymology edit
From Swedish limpa (“loaf [of bread]”).
Noun edit
limpa (uncountable)
- Swedish-style rye bread made with molasses.
- Synonyms: limpa bread, Swedish limpa bread

Indonesian edit
Etymology edit
Cognate with Javanese ꦭꦶꦩ꧀ꦥ (limpa)
Pronunciation edit
Noun edit
limpa (first-person possessive limpaku, second-person possessive limpamu, third-person possessive limpanya)
- (anatomy) spleen, in vertebrates, including humans, a ductless vascular gland, located in the left upper abdomen near the stomach, which destroys old red blood cells, removes debris from the bloodstream, acts as a reservoir of blood, and produces lymphocytes.
- Synonym: lien
